A 19.2 g quantity of dry ice (solid carbon dioxide) is allowed to sublime (evaporate) in an apparatus like the one shown in Figure 6.5. Calculate the expansion work done in kJ against a constant external pressure of 0.961 atm and at a constant temperature of 20°C. Assume that the initial volume of dry ice is negligible and that CO2 behaves like an ideal gas.
